Biography

Caitlin Bump, M.D. is a board-certified obstetrician-gynecologist (OB/GYN). She provides compassionate care to patients at all stages of life. Dr. Bump is also a licensed acupuncturist. To treat the whole patient, she combines her medical training and education in Complementary and Alternative Medicine.

Dr. Bump seeks to encourage patients to protect their health through prevention. She is interested in how alternative health methods can support overall wellness.

A native of the Hudson Valley in New York, Dr. Bump likes being close to both the mountains and the coast in Portland. She enjoys traveling, yoga, trying new foods and getting outdoors.

Dr. Bump sees patients at OHSU Center for Women's Health and OHSU Health Hillsboro Medical Center.
